Output 3087030eb5e6905d32df2a27aff1733ba53bcb7a61baa45ebd3630f949a47b8f:0

value
17435579
script pubkey
OP_0 OP_PUSHBYTES_20 e260467f81ab1bb0bddd46fa13ab19d158695ea1
address
bc1qufsyvlup4vdmp0wagmap82ce69vxjh4p2j5y9a
transaction
3087030eb5e6905d32df2a27aff1733ba53bcb7a61baa45ebd3630f949a47b8f
confirmations
324027
spent
true